After that unbelievable third day for India where Shikhar Dhawan played an absolutely blistering innings, the hosts will look to push on and post a big lead against Australia in the fourth day of the third Test at Mohali.

Dhawan is not out on 185 on his debut after breaking several records, with Murali Vijay giving him good company on 83 as India make hay on 283 for no loss after Australia were all out for 408.

"I wasn't really playing in a hurry," said Dhawan, who scored his 185 unbeaten in just 168 balls. "The fours were coming on their own after the ball hit the bat. But I guess I was in good flow today.

"I felt my shot selection was good and I played according to how I'd assessed the wicket. I didn't feel that I rushed things. There was no strategy, I was hitting the ball well, I was middling the ball very nicely and the runs came on their own. My only focus was that I'd play the ball on merit.

The other standout performer of the day was Mitchell Starc, with the fast bowler's 99 understandably overshadowed by Dhawan's blitzkrieg.

"I was just enjoying it up until I got out," fast bowler Starc said. "At the start of the day I was just hanging around for hopefully Steve Smith to get a ton. Unfortunately he didn't get there and that was just a lot of fun to play the way I liked to (after Smith's dismissal) and play my shots.

"To fall one short is disappointing and hopefully I can get another chance one day. I felt a bit nervous and it probably felt a bit harder ... when you get to 99. It's something I can learn from and I'm still happy I got that far."
